"Weeping willow trees” appearance ?

Q..All are true regarding imaging finding in cirrhosis of liver except
a.flying bat pattern on scintigraphy
b.bone marrow uptake of radionuclide
c.corkscrew appearance of intrahepatic areteries on angiography
d.weeping willow trees appearance on hepatic venography
e.Hypointense T2W appearance of regenerative nodules
ANS.----d

“Weeping willow trees” appearance (hepatic vein branches getting close ) on hepatic venography is noted in idiopathic portal hypertension

HIPPOCAMPAL SCLEROSIS

Q.All are true regarding hippocampal sclerosis except
a. The amygdala remains superior to temporal horn
b.  the CSF signal in the uncal recess of temporal horn / the alveus seprate amygdale from hippocampus
c. Both amygdala and hippocampus are hypointense to gray matter on almost all  MR pulse sequences.
d.The hippocampus may be slightly hyperintense to gray matter on FLAIR images

e. the posterior hippocampal boundary for volumetry extend to the crus of the fornix  


ANS.----c
Both amygdala and hippocampus are isointense to gray matter on all MR pulse sequences. The hippocampus, however, may be slightly hyperintense to gray matter on fluid attenuated inversion recovery (FLAIR) images due to incomplete suppression of CSF
